The Prevention and Corruption ( Amendment) Bill, 2013 is passed by Rajya Sabha

In this Bill giving and taking bribes are both punished as found earlier.

Minimum punishment as sought in this bill is raised from 6 months to 3 years AND maximum punishment is raised from 5 years to 7 years.

Keeping in mind to comply with the UN’s Convention Against Corruption, the Bill has made 43 amendments filling the gaps in corruption law.

The corruption is now categorized under “HEINOUS CRIME”.

LOKPAL/LOKAYUKTA is taken out and ‘Competent Authority’ is brought in. The Competent Authority is vested with the power to order an investigation against a corrupt official of government, public servant.

The bribe givers can declare that they were coerced to give bribe. If proved, they can claim immunity from punishment.
